News Fox competition winners learn to navigate the business world 17 October 2011 Angelo Fichera An alumnus and chemistry professor continue talks with customers, investors. When alumnus Lev Davidson was a graduate student last spring, he took home the grand prize of the Be Your Own Boss Bowl. Months later,